When it comes to choosing between silk and satin, the difference goes far beyond just texture. Silk is a natural fiber prized for its breathability and softness, while satin is a weave that offers a smooth, glossy finish—often made with synthetic materials like polyester. Mother’s Day, or holiday meant to honor our moms, and is celebrated in more than 100 countries around the world. In the U.S., we celebrate Mother's on the second Sunday in May. In other countries, including many in Eastern Europe, Mother's day is a holiday that celebrates their family matriarchs on International Women’s Day, March 8, while in many Arab nations they celebrate it on the day of Spring Equinox, March 21.
